Checking error messages
If the Drystar 5300 is not printing your job, you should check the front panel
display to see if the Drystar 5300 is indicating an error status.
The operator is notified of the situation by means of an error screen and a beep.

Checking CF-card error messages
If the Drystar 5300 is not printing your job, you should check the front panel
display to see if the Drystar 5300 is indicating an error status.
A CF-card error can occur when the inserted CF-card is full, write protected
or unreadable.
1
Correct the error following the error message on the screen:
Compact Flash error
xxx explanatory text
x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x
After you have corrected the action the screen will disappear.
